背景介绍
在数据分析与可视化项目中,文件处理是基础且关键的环节。通过读取本地文件内容并保存到其他文件,可以有效实现数据的隔离与管理,避免数据丢失和重复操作。本脚本通过Python实现读取本地文件内容并保存到目标文件中,确保读取与保存过程的独立性。
解题思路
问题分析
该问题要求实现两个独立操作:读取输入文件并保存结果到输出文件。其核心思想是通过文件读写操作,实现数据的隔离处理。关键点包括:
- 读取输入文件,确保读取内容的完整性;
- 保存结果到输出文件,确保数据的独立性;
- 确保文件操作的独立性,避免外部依赖。
代码实现
# 读取文件
with open("input.txt", "r", encoding="utf-8") as f:
data = f.read()
# 保存结果
with open("output.txt", "w", encoding="utf-8") as f:
f.write("Read from input.txt: " + data)
学习价值
此脚本涉及核心技术点:文件读写与数据处理。
核心技术点解析
- 文件读写操作:使用Python的
with语句确保文件的正确读写,避免资源泄露。 - 文件内容的完整性:通过读取原始文件内容,确保数据的完整性和一致性。
- 数据保存的独立性:实现读取与保存过程的独立性,避免数据丢失或重复操作。
脚本的可运行性
本脚本无需依赖外部服务,直接在终端或终端环境运行即可。该脚本的完整性和可运行性确保了其作为独立文件处理脚本的可行性。
总结
通过该脚本实现读取和保存本地文件内容到其他文件的功能,可以有效提升数据处理的效率和独立性。本脚本的核心技术点在于文件读写操作的实现,为数据处理提供了可扩展和可复用的解决方案。